The Yemeni Embassy in Morocco organized a football tournament to commemorate the 61st anniversary of the October 14 Revolution. The event took place at Ibn Rushd Stadium in Rabat, featuring teams from Rabat and Kenitra, comprised of Yemeni students studying at Moroccan universities.
During the event, Ambassador Azzaldin Al-Asbahi addressed attendees, including embassy members, the Yemeni community, and students. He emphasized that celebrating the anniversary of the October 14 Revolution reaffirms the ongoing success of this significant movement, which aims to secure Yemen’s future and empower youth in nation-building.
Al-Asbahi stated, “The unity of the great Yemeni revolutions of September and October has solidified through the strength of this people. We see this spirit embodied in these young individuals who exemplify a commitment to education and openness to modernity. They reject any fragmentation of our great nation and stand firm against the Houthi militias that seek to return the people of wisdom and faith to the shadows.”
The ambassador extended his congratulations to the political leadership, specifically President Dr. Rashad Mohammed Al-Alimi, the Presidential Leadership Council, and the government, on this momentous occasion.
At the conclusion of the tournament, Ambassador Al-Asbahi presented the championship trophy and gold medals to the Rabat team, who secured first place. The Kenitra team, which finished in second place, received silver medals.
